The wounds of betrayal never heal! by @ Setting FiresLooking to add a bit of variety to your ADC pool? Try out Setting Fires' Kalista guide to master this mechanically demanding Marksman. Utilize the early game power of Hail of Blades or the scaling DPS from Lethal Tempo combined with Settings Fires' custom keybindings to outmaneuver and chase down your targets. Other mechanical tricks like hopping walls with Pierce are explained in detail and the author even provides a map of which walls on the Rift you can hop with a simple Q. Kalista isn't for the faint of heart, but she's a great champion if you're interested in challenging mechanical champions like Yasuo and Riven or highly mobile ADCs like Lucian.
Yeager's Master Orianna guide by @ Yeager Orianna is one of those timeless mid laners that seems to remain relevant in any meta. She's got a little bit of everything from early bullying, to waveclear and team fighting power. It's a great asset for new mid lane or Orianna players that Yeager's guide covers all the basic information you'll need to get good at Orianna. Be sure to check out the Combos section to learn to Command Orianna and her ball to their fullest potential. The tips and tricks and wave control chapters are also welcome inclusions, as the best Orianna players are also master wave manipulators and know how to make the most out of every ability.
Light 'Em Up (I'm on fiyaa): Luxeøn Style by @ LuxTheGreyWardenLuxeøn's Lux guide returns to the spotlight this week as it's one of the best updated guides for Preseason 10. If you haven't seen this guide yet, take a peek to see how incredibly detailed and well-presented every chapter is. The "Detailed Matchups" chapter is an understatement, as the author includes just about every mid lane matchup under the sun and neatly organizes them into alphabetized spoilers so you can quickly find the matchup you're looking for. Lux is a popular and super fun champion to learn, so if you're interested in the champion, definitely check out this guide and give her a whirl.
